Identity Theft/Phishing. This isn't so much a tax reduction scam as a nightmare wherein identity thieves try to have transfer pricing information from taxpayers by acting as IRS specialists. Often they send out email as though they are from the Internal revenue service. The IRS never sends emails to taxpayers, so don't respond to the telltale emails. If you aren't sure, call the IRS and question them if there could problem. Might reach the irs at 800-829-1040.
So far, so good. If a married couple's income is under $32,000 ($25,000 for just about any single taxpayer), Social Security benefits are not taxable. If combined salary is between $32,000 and $44,000 (or $25,000 and $34,000 for a single person), the taxable quantity of Social Security equals the lesser of one half of Social Security benefits or half of enough time to create between combined income and $32,000 ($25,000 if single).
